What are Grizzly Bears?

What are Grizzly Bears?

Grizzly bears are a subspecies of brown bears found primarily in North America. They are characterized by their large size, with [censured] males weighing between 400 to 1,500 pounds. Grizzly bears have a distinctive hump on their shoulders, which is made of muscle used for digging. Their fur can vary in color from blonde to dark brown, often with lighter tips. Grizzly bears are omnivorous, feeding on plants, berries, fish, and small mammals. They are known for their solitary behavior, except during mating season and when mothers are raising cubs. Grizzly bears typically inhabit forests, mountains, and tundra regions. Their population has been affected by habitat loss and human interactions, leading to conservation efforts aimed at protecting their habitats and ensuring their survival.

How do physical traits distinguish Grizzly Bears from other bear species?

Grizzly Bears are distinguished from other bear species by their unique physical traits. They possess a prominent hump on their shoulders, which is due to large muscles used for digging. Their fur is often a mix of brown and blonde, giving them a grizzled appearance. Grizzly Bears have long claws, typically measuring up to 4 inches, which aid in digging and foraging. Additionally, they have a broader skull shape compared to black bears. Their size also sets them apart; [censured] Grizzly Bears can weigh between 400 to 1,500 pounds. These physical characteristics contribute to their ability to adapt to various habitats.

What common scenarios lead to human-Grizzly Bear interactions?

Common scenarios that lead to human-Grizzly Bear interactions include food-related encounters and habitat encroachment. Bears often seek food in human-populated areas, especially during spring and fall. This behavior increases when natural food sources are scarce. Campgrounds, garbage sites, and agricultural fields attract Grizzly Bears. Additionally, urban development reduces bear habitats, forcing them into closer proximity with humans. Recreational activities like hiking and camping can also result in unexpected encounters. According to a study published in the Journal of Wildlife Management, over 70% of human-bear conflicts are linked to food rewards. This data highlights the importance of managing food sources to reduce interactions.

How does changing weather patterns affect food sources for Grizzly Bears?

Changing weather patterns significantly impact food sources for Grizzly Bears. These bears rely on specific seasonal food availability. Warmer temperatures can alter the timing of plant growth and berry production. For example, earlier springs may lead to mismatches in food availability. This affects the bears’ foraging behavior and nutritional intake. Additionally, changing precipitation patterns can impact salmon runs. Salmon are a crucial food source for Grizzly Bears during the fall. Research shows that shifts in climate have been linked to decreased salmon populations in some regions. Consequently, food scarcity can lead to increased competition among bears. This can result in lower survival rates, especially for cubs.

What role do wildlife corridors play in Grizzly Bear conservation strategies?

Wildlife corridors are crucial for Grizzly Bear conservation strategies. They facilitate movement between fragmented habitats. This movement is essential for genetic diversity among bear populations. Genetic diversity helps ensure the long-term survival of species. Corridors also provide access to food sources and mating opportunities. Studies show that bears using corridors have higher survival rates. For example, a study by McRae et al. (2008) found that wildlife corridors significantly increase bear population connectivity. Improved connectivity reduces human-bear conflicts by allowing bears to avoid populated areas. Thus, wildlife corridors play a vital role in sustaining Grizzly Bear populations.

What precautions should be taken when hiking in Grizzly Bear territory?

When hiking in Grizzly Bear territory, it is crucial to take specific precautions to ensure safety. Always travel in groups, as bears are less likely to approach larger numbers of people. Make noise while hiking to alert bears to your presence. This can include talking, clapping, or using bear bells. Keep food stored properly in bear-proof containers or hung from trees at least 10 feet off the ground and 4 feet from the trunk. Avoid hiking at dawn or dusk when bears are most active. Carry bear spray and know how to use it effectively. Stay on marked trails to minimize encounters with wildlife. Finally, educate yourself about bear behavior and signs of recent bear activity in the area. These precautions are supported by wildlife management guidelines to reduce the risk of bear encounters and ensure both human and bear safety.
